Wednesday, December 7, 2016

My Dictionary; Word of the Day


(ˈliɡ-ə-mən-tCHo͝or) anatomical noun / adj. from Middle English via the Latin ligare, "to bind".  Of or relating to an overall area of ligaments within an individual organisms body.

As in, "Though injured, the beast lunged forward with mouth agape, moving far in excess of the physical limitations of its ligamenture".

